ISE REST API: CRUD for Network Access Policy Sets

I'm working on using the ISE 2.4 REST API to automate the deployment of Wired Authentication for my clients.  I can create a lot of the required elements (External Identity Sources, Network Devices, Authorization Policy) from the API, but I don't see any way of doing CRUD operations on Network Access Policy Sets (Authentication Policy, Conditions, Description, Policy Set Name).

I've looked at the PxGrid API and didn't see anything related to policy sets in that documentation as well.  Is there support for Network Access Policy Set CRUD operations?

Nope. Today, the only policy supported with CRUD in ISE ERS API is that of ANC.
